A till receipt printer is a device that prints out receipts for customers after they make a purchase at a retail store or restaurant. While it may seem like a simple piece of equipment, the till receipt printer serves multiple essential functions that benefit both the business and the customer.

One of the primary functions of a till receipt printer is to provide customers with a record of their transaction. The receipt typically includes the date and time of the purchase, the items bought, the total amount paid, and any applicable taxes or discounts. This information is crucial for customers who may need to return or exchange items, track their expenses, or reconcile their purchases with their bank statements. Without a till receipt printer, businesses would have to rely on handwritten receipts, which are prone to errors and can be easily misplaced.

Additionally, a till receipt printer helps businesses maintain accurate records of their sales transactions. By automatically printing receipts for every purchase, businesses can keep track of their daily sales, monitor inventory levels, and analyze customer buying patterns. This data is invaluable for making informed business decisions, such as determining which products are selling well and which ones need to be restocked.

Furthermore, a till receipt printer enhances the overall customer experience by speeding up the checkout process. Customers appreciate the convenience of receiving a printed receipt immediately after their purchase, rather than having to wait for a handwritten one or no receipt at all. This efficiency helps reduce waiting times at the checkout counter, leading to increased customer satisfaction and loyalty.

Moreover, a till receipt printer plays a vital role in compliance with legal and financial regulations. In many jurisdictions, businesses are required by law to provide customers with a receipt for their purchases, especially for tax purposes. Failing to do so can result in penalties and legal consequences for the business. Additionally, having accurate records of transactions is essential for accounting purposes and ensuring that the business remains financially sound.

In recent years, advancements in technology have led to the development of more sophisticated till receipt printers that offer additional features and benefits. Modern till receipt printers are equipped with connectivity options, such as Bluetooth and Wi-Fi, allowing businesses to print receipts wirelessly from any location in the store. Some printers also include built-in barcode scanners, customer displays, and touchscreens, further enhancing the customer experience and streamlining the checkout process.

Furthermore, till receipt printers are now more environmentally friendly than ever before. Many businesses have switched to using thermal receipt paper, which does not require ink or ribbons for printing, reducing waste and saving costs in the long run. Additionally, some till receipt printers offer the option to email receipts to customers instead of printing them, further reducing paper usage and promoting sustainability.
